The story of Retouch4me Portrait Volumes v1.020 is a tale of how artificial intelligence is being harnessed to solve one of the most meticulous challenges in digital photography: adding "presence" to a portrait that looks technically perfect but feels visually flat. The Quest for Depth
In the world of professional retouching, creating a three-dimensional feel often requires a technique called Dodge & Burn. This manual process—where a retoucher carefully lightens and darkens specific pixels—can take hours of painstaking work with a stylus or mouse.
Portrait Volumes was born to automate this "finishing" stage. Unlike other AI tools that focus on cleaning up blemishes or smoothing skin, this software is designed for contouring. It analyzes the lighting and facial structure of a subject to intelligently: Draw the oval of the face for better definition. Brighten the iris of the eyes to add a "sparkle". Emphasize lips and the nose to make features "pop".
Apply natural shadows under the chin and along facial contours to counteract the flattening effect of soft, even studio lighting. The Evolution: Version 1.020

Retouch4me Portrait Volumes v1.020: The Ultimate Guide to AI-Powered Depth
Capturing a stunning portrait is only half the battle; the post-processing phase often defines the professional quality of the final image. Retouch4me Portrait Volumes v1.020 is an AI-driven tool designed to solve one of the most common issues in photography: "flat" images caused by soft lighting or lens compression. By automatically sculpting light and shadow, this plugin restores a 3D feel to your subjects in seconds. What is Retouch4me Portrait Volumes?
Retouch4me Portrait Volumes is a specialized retouching application and plugin that utilizes neural networks to enhance visual dimensions. Unlike traditional dodge and burn techniques that can take hours of manual painting, this AI analyzes facial structures—like cheekbones, noses, and eyes—and applies smart highlights and shadows to make features "pop". Key Features of Version 1.020
The v1.020 update refined the core neural network to provide more accurate results and addressed specific user feedback from previous versions.
Automatic 3D Sculpting: It creates a depth map of the subject to ensure light rolloff is gradual and natural.
Targeted Enhancements: Automatically brightens eyes and adds definition to lips and the bridge of the nose.
Soft Light Correction: Specifically designed for portraits shot with softboxes or in overcast conditions where facial contours often disappear. Day 30
Batch Processing: Allows photographers to apply the same level of depth to hundreds of photos simultaneously, a massive time-saver for high-volume studios.
Non-Destructive Workflow: The plugin can output its effects to a neutral gray layer (using Soft Light mode), allowing you to adjust the intensity via layer opacity in Adobe Photoshop. Why Use Version 1.020?
The v1.020 release focuses on stability and visual fidelity. A critical improvement in this version was the fix for a "gray shadows" bug, which previously caused some shadow areas to look muddy or desaturated. This update ensures that the added depth remains vibrant and true to the original skin tones. System Requirements & Compatibility

What Does It Do?
In simple terms, Portrait Volumes adds depth. When you take a photo, especially with flat lighting, a face can look 2D or "squashed." This plugin automatically identifies the high points of the face (cheekbones, bridge of the nose, forehead center) and adds light (dodge), while identifying the low points (hollows of cheeks, sides of the nose) and adds shadow (burn).
It creates a "Dodge & Burn" map automatically, saving retouchers hours of tedious manual work.
